Clay roof tiles in New Mexico

New Mexico, featuring the distinctive landscape of Albuquerque, offers a climate where the resilience and classic style of clay roof tiles are particularly well-suited.

The Land of Enchantment experiences a semi-arid to arid climate characterized by abundant sunshine, significant diurnal temperature variations, and low humidity, with occasional monsoon rains in the summer and light snowfall in the winter. These conditions demand roofing materials that can withstand intense UV exposure, rapid temperature fluctuations, and the challenges posed by infrequent but potentially intense precipitation. Clay tiles, with their inherent thermal mass, fire resistance, and natural ability to withstand harsh sunlight, provide an ideal solution for New Mexico's environment, complementing its unique architectural vernacular, from adobe-inspired structures to contemporary designs. What makes clay tiles ideal for Albuquerque's climate?

Clay roof tiles are exceptionally suited for Albuquerque's climate due to their inherent resistance to intense solar radiation, their thermal mass which helps regulate indoor temperatures, and their fire-retardant properties. Their classic aesthetic also complements the region's unique architectural styles, providing a durable and visually appealing roofing solution.
